The Allen-Bradley 20DR125A0NNNANNNN, part of the PowerFlex 700S series, is an adjustable frequency AC drive engineered for high-performance applications. This model supports 650V DC operational voltage and operates with a three-phase power design. The drive is rated for an input current of up to 125 amps, accommodating significant electrical loads.
It features a compact and durable IP20 enclosure, aligned with NEMA Type 1 standards, suitable for a variety of industrial environments. The device does not include a braking system, facilitating straightforward functionality in typical motor control scenarios.
Safety mechanisms include an adjustable bus undervoltage trip, allowing settings to prevent operation under unsafe voltage conditions. Additionally, the drive is equipped with a heat sink thermistor that is actively monitored by a built-in microprocessor, ensuring immediate response if overheating occurs.
Operational stability is ensured with configurable logic control ride-thru support for 0.25 seconds during inactive states. Additionally, the drive can maintain power ride-thru for 15 milliseconds while under full load conditions, safeguarding against momentary power fluctuations.
